Hello friends,

I have been posting in a separate thread about my op and recovery. However I need help from anyone who may have tips or tricks...

Days 1-4 post op were showing great progress. Now, it’s day 7 and somewhere around the day 5 mark, I went from walking more and feeling progress, so extreme pain and feeling like my crotch has been lit on fire.

Made an appointment with the doctor and he said zero signs of infection, zero signs of problems. But this pain that started around day 5 is excruciating and there is no way to sit or lay that provides relief. Has anyone experienced this?

Description of pain:

Laying on my back, makes it just hurt
Walking is like a countdown, two minutes from unbearable pain
If anything touches the penis, even blankets moving on the bed... oh boy
Ice provides some relief, very temporary

Perhaps ask for a Gabapentin prescription, it helps with nerve pain. My urologist prescribes this for pain after implant. He also said that young men tend to feel more pain as they high more sensitivity in their genitals.

Are you still inflated? If so, deflating would help tremendously as well based on accounts I have read.

I'm assuming this was a tongue-in-cheek comment.

Just in case, you were aware that "cycling" means inflating and deflating the implant to stretch the penis, right?
